How Long Does It Take To Walk a Marathon? Walking a marathon will take you anything between 6 and 9 hours, depending on your pace. Brisk walkers who march the course can expect to finish in 6-7 hours. Walking at a regular pace will take around 8 hours.

How long will it take to walk 26.2 miles?

Many walkers set a goal of walking the 26.2-mile competition, which can generally be achieved in six to eight hours (or more) at a walking pace.

Is walking a marathon harder than running?

Walking a marathon is both easier and harder than running a marathon, with completion being the most important goal. The amount of distance training per week is somewhat less than for running and the intensity level is quite a bit less.

How do you walk a marathon in 5 hours?

Training Tips for Walking a 5 to 6+ Hour Marathon

  • consisting of long walks.
  • hill workouts.
  • tempo walks.
  • rest days.
  • Plan to walk or cross train 4-6 days per week.
  • Build mileage slowly each week.
  • Give yourself at least 5 months to train.
  • Instead of focusing on distance, you'll often train by time.

    Can you walk a half marathon in 3 hours?

    The half marathon is 13.1 miles or 21 kilometers long. It will take 3 to 4 hours to complete at a continuous brisk walking pace. You will need to build up your walking distance over the course of a couple of months to cross the finish line feeling great.

    Can you walk 26 miles in a day?

    Estimate Your Walking Distance

    A trained walker can walk a 26.2-mile marathon in eight hours or less, or walk 20 to 30 miles in a day. Steadily building your mileage with training allows you to walk long distances with less risk of injury.

    Is it possible to walk a marathon without training?

    Even if you're walking, attempting a marathon without training isn't a good idea. Walking a marathon means that you'll be spending 6+ hours on your feet, which can take a big toll on your body. It's a good idea to train for any race, no matter the distance and no matter if you walk or run.

    Is it OK to walk during a marathon?

    It's completely OK to walk a marathon! Nowadays, it's becoming more common for walkers to complete marathons. Many marathons allow for generous cut-off times and ensure support is provided for those marathoners who choose to walk the 26.2 miles.

    How many hours does it take to run a marathon?

    On average, men complete a marathon in a little more than 4 hours, while women take roughly 4.5 hours. The marathon running population is typically 30-40 percent female and 60-70 percent male. People of all ages complete a marathon, though the bulk are between 30 and 50 years of age.

    How many miles is 10000 steps?

    An average person has a stride length of approximately 2.1 to 2.5 feet. That means that it takes over 2,000 steps to walk one mile and 10,000 steps would be almost 5 miles.

    Can humans outrun any animal?

    But when it comes to long distances, humans can outrun almost any animal. Because we cool by sweating rather than panting, we can stay cool at speeds and distances that would overheat other animals. On a hot day, the two scientists wrote, a human could even outrun a horse in a 26.2-mile marathon.

    Which is the most difficult marathon?

    Finally, allow us to introduce the Inca Trail Marathon, accepted as the most difficult marathon in the world. With inclines and declines of great extremes, the course is estimated to be as difficult as running nearly two tough marathons in a row.
